ATLANTA, Ga. – The Kennesaw State track and field teams opened the outdoor season at the Yellow Jacket Invitational on Friday. It was the first time KSU had competed in an outdoor meet as a team in 671 days. The 2020 outdoor season was canceled due to health concerns related to COVID-19.

School Record
- Tyler Blalock took second in the shot put with a toss of 18.29m (60'0.25") to break his own school record in the event.

Men's Top Performances
- Tyler Blalock was runner-up in the hammer throw with a toss of 52.23m (171'4").
- Freshman Caleb Hartley took third in the hammer throw with a mark of 44.78m (146'11") and fourth in the shot put with a toss of 15.73m (51'7.25").
- Freshman David Olusanya leapt 6.67m (21'10.25") to finish third in the long jump.
- Koi Williams ran a personal-best time of 3:56.58 to finish 16th in the 1500m.
- Paris Williams finished fourth in the 100m in a personal-best time of 10.76 seconds.
Â
Women's Top Performances
- Tiondra Grant landed an outdoor personal-best mark of 13.21m (43'4.25) to finish third in the shot put.
- Kaitlyn Corral had a personal-best toss of 38.85m (127'5") to take fourth in the javelin.
- Louise Tocays ran a time of 12.08 seconds finishing second in the 100m.
- Rachel Van Amburgh took sixth in the 1500m with a time of 4:35.45.
- Makenzie Zeh (16:45.47) and Katie Meyer (17:01.54) ran outdoor personal-best times to finish second and third in the 5k.

Quotable
Director of Track and Field Cale McDaniel
On the team's performance today …
"It was really nice getting outdoor started close to home and having the Owls out on the track again. The night ended with a clean sweep in the women's 5K. It will be a lot of fun to see how the team does when we get after it tomorrow."
